Where
Where

Power systems engineer jobs in Thulamahashi (1 jobs)

Company
Schedule
Employment
Source
Profession
Location
Sort by:
  • Executive Placements
  • Thulamahashi
... responsiveness Maintain and monitor backup power systems (generators, inverters, solar setups) Ensure ... , and general building systems Experience with solar power, borehole/water systems, and generator ...
4 days ago